From Builder to Finished: Interior Design Transformation

More than a decade after building their new home, our clients partnered with us to transform their space into a personalized, custom-designed residence that truly reflects their lifestyle and aesthetic. Over the course of eight years, we collaborated on a comprehensive residential interior design project that reimagined nine rooms, blending contemporary design with warm, livable elegance.

Our goal was to enhance both style and functionality while creating inviting spaces that encourage connection and everyday comfort. Through thoughtful space planning, architectural enhancements, and custom furnishings, we elevated the home from a standard builder-grade interior to a refined, cohesive luxury interior design.

In the dramatic two-story family room, we introduced architectural detailing with custom wainscot trim on the upper level to create visual interest and a more intimate atmosphere. The fireplace was redesigned and expanded to become a striking focal point, while comfortable seating arrangements encourage gathering and relaxation.

The formal living room was reimagined as a sophisticated music room centered around the family’s grand piano. Rich wallpaper, custom drapery, and statement lighting add texture and elegance, creating a space that the family enjoys every day.

A former first-floor office with an ensuite bath was transformed into a versatile multipurpose guest suite. Custom cabinetry integrates a concealed Murphy bed, functional desk space, seating area, and gaming table, maximizing both flexibility and storage. A dramatic dark blue cork wallpaper ceiling, luxurious upholstery fabrics, and tailored window treatments introduce depth and quiet sophistication. Distinctive lighting fixtures and a two-way fireplace complete the design, creating a cozy retreat for both family time and visiting guests.

Project Features and Highlights

In the multi-purpose room, custom cabinets feature a murphy bed and concealed desk area as well as ample storage space. 

Throughout the space, luxurious fabrics and wallcoverings add color and texture, complemented by striking light fixtures, curated accents and custom art, resulting in a meticulously finished look.

For durability and aesthetics, the custom furniture is upholstered in performance fabrics that compliments the family’s collection of hand-knotted persian style rugs

To counteract the cavernous feeling of the two-story family room, we implemented ‘reverse’ wainscoting on the upper section, introducing a unique architectural element
